У меня закончилось место на диске на сервере ubuntu. Как я могу узнать, как используется дисковое пространство, чтобы очистить диск / удалить ненужные файлы?
df -h
: сообщит вам об использовании пространства всех смонтированных файловых систем.du -sh
: расскажет вам об использовании места в текущем каталоге.du -h --max-depth=1
: расскажет вам об использовании пространства каждого каталога в текущем каталоге.Пытаться Использование диска NCurses. Его чертовски удобно использовать в качестве инструмента для конечного пользователя (в отличие от того, что программист может использовать в сценарии).
Список файлов / папок по размеру в порядке убывания;
du -sk * |sort -rn
В удобочитаемых размерах (только сортировка GNU);
du -sh * |sort -rh
du - это команда для задания, поскольку она дает вам информацию об использовании диска.
Попробуйте бежать du -sh
в корневом каталоге, а затем в каталогах ниже.
Надеюсь это поможет.
графическая программа, которая мне нравится, KDirStat
. Кто-то еще упомянул ncdu
и это приятно. KDirStat
дает вам полный обзор всего вашего диска.